New England weather hits Somerville garage doors hard. Winter freeze-thaw cycles cause metal components to contract and expand, which is why we see a spike in broken spring calls every February and March. Salt air drifting in from the coast accelerates rust on cables and rollers. Summer humidity can warp wooden doors, making them stick or bind in the tracks.

The most common issue we handle in Somerville? Torsion spring failure. These springs typically last 7 to 9 years (not the 10 that some manufacturers claim), and when they break, your door isn't going anywhere. We also see plenty of opener problems, especially in homes where the original unit has been running for 15-plus years without maintenance.

What We Do for Somerville Homeowners

Our spring replacement service is our most requested call in Somerville. When a torsion spring snaps, we can usually have a technician at your door the same day with the right springs already on the truck. We replace both springs at once (even if only one broke) because the second one is under the same stress and will fail soon anyway.

Garage door opener installation is another specialty. We install LiftMaster, Chamberlain, and Genie openers, and we'll help you choose the right horsepower and features for your door weight and usage patterns. Belt drive openers are quieter (important if you have bedrooms above the garage), while chain drive units offer more lifting power for heavier wooden doors.

Cable and roller repair keeps your door running smoothly. Frayed cables are a safety hazard, and worn rollers create that grinding noise you hear every morning. We replace these components before they cause bigger problems like a door coming off the tracks.

Full door replacement becomes necessary when panels are severely damaged or when repair costs approach 50% of a new door's price. We'll walk you through material options (steel, aluminum, wood composite) and insulation values that make sense for your budget.

What does spring replacement cost in Somerville?

Standard torsion spring replacement for a two-car garage door typically runs $225 to $295, including both springs and labor. Heavier doors or high-cycle springs (rated for more open/close cycles) cost more. Single-car doors are usually $175 to $235. These prices include our warranty on parts and labor.
